在当今互联网时代,GitHub作为一个重要的代码托管平台,吸引了全球开发者的关注。然而,由于某些地区的网络限制,访问GitHub可能会遇到困难。本文将详细介绍如何通过科学上网的方式顺利访问GitHub,包括使用VPN、代理和其他网络工具的具体方法。
什么是科学上网?
科学上网是指通过各种技术手段,绕过网络限制,访问被屏蔽的网站和服务。对于开发者而言,科学上网不仅可以访问GitHub,还能获取最新的技术资源和社区支持。
为什么需要科学上网访问GitHub?
- 获取开源项目:GitHub上有大量的开源项目,科学上网可以帮助开发者获取这些资源。
- 参与社区:许多技术讨论和问题解决都在GitHub上进行,科学上网可以让开发者参与其中。
- 更新和维护:许多开发工具和库的更新都在GitHub上发布,科学上网可以确保及时获取最新版本。
如何科学上网访问GitHub?
1. 使用VPN
VPN(虚拟私人网络)是科学上网最常用的方法之一。通过VPN,用户可以将自己的网络流量加密,并通过其他国家的服务器访问互联网。
如何选择VPN?
- 速度:选择速度快的VPN,以确保访问GitHub时不会出现延迟。
- 稳定性:选择稳定性高的VPN,避免频繁掉线。
- 隐私保护:确保VPN提供商有良好的隐私政策,保护用户数据。
VPN使用步骤
- 选择并下载VPN客户端。
- 安装并注册账户。
- 连接到一个可用的服务器。
- 打开浏览器,访问GitHub。
2. 使用代理
代理服务器是另一种科学上网的方法。通过代理,用户可以将请求发送到代理服务器,由代理服务器转发请求到目标网站。
代理的类型
- HTTP代理:适用于网页浏览,速度较快。
- SOCKS代理:适用于各种网络协议,灵活性更高。
代理使用步骤
- 找到一个可靠的代理服务。
- 配置浏览器或系统的代理设置。
- 访问GitHub。
3. 使用Shadowsocks
Shadowsocks是一种安全的代理工具,广泛用于科学上网。它通过加密流量来保护用户隐私。
Shadowsocks使用步骤
- 下载并安装Shadowsocks客户端。
- 配置服务器信息。
- 启动Shadowsocks,连接到服务器。
- 访问GitHub。
常见问题解答(FAQ)
如何选择合适的VPN?
选择合适的VPN时,用户应考虑速度、稳定性、隐私保护和价格等因素。可以参考用户评价和专业评测。
科学上网是否合法?
科学上网的合法性因国家而异。在某些国家,使用VPN和代理是合法的,而在另一些国家则可能受到限制。用户应了解当地法律法规。
使用科学上网会影响网络速度吗?
使用科学上网工具可能会影响网络速度,尤其是当连接到远程服务器时。选择速度快且稳定的服务可以减少这种影响。
如何确保安全性?
使用科学上网工具时,确保选择信誉良好的服务提供商,并定期更新软件以防止安全漏洞。
结论
科学上网是开发者访问GitHub的重要手段。通过使用VPN、代理和Shadowsocks等工具,用户可以顺利访问GitHub,获取丰富的技术资源。希望本文能为您提供有价值的指导,帮助您更好地利用GitHub。
正文完